Administrator, Director of Patient Support Services Patient Advocate (old timer, 2000 posts) Joined: Jun 2007 Posts: 10,507 Likes: 7 | Many members have found it much easier to get thru rads when they get hydrated a few times a week. Dehydration (and malnutrition) can be a huge problem for OC patients! Ask the doc for a prescription for the hydration.
If your brother is in pain make certain he is taking pain meds. Some guys try to tough it out but it does absolutely no good at all to be hurting, its actually detrimental to the patient.
